Claim of foreign exporter to India as owner of goods seeking to re-export - seizure of cargo currently lying in a warehouse at Gandhidham - Mere filing of the ex-bond bill of entry, by itself, would not vest the title of the goods into the importer if ultimately such goods are not cleared by the importer, or in other words, if such goods are abandoned. In such circumstances also, the title over the imported goods would remain with the exporter and the exporter may, in peculiar facts and circumstances of the case like the one on hand, request the Commissioner to permit him to reexport the goods as an unpaid seller - Undoubtedly, the writ-applicant herein is the unpaid seller and he has been suffering for no fault on his part. - This writ-application permitted to file an application addressed to the Commissioner seeking re-export of the goods. - HC
